The Church was built on the old monastic site and the owner of the land is not bothered fixing it up. how close is nasa to cryosleepWebJun 8, 2024 · A map produced in 1731, is the first to show a Roman Catholic church in the area. It had been built five years earlier in 1726, and it stood until 1969, when it was demolished to make way for the existing St Agnes Church.
